What Makes Infectious Waste Unique?

Infectious waste differs fundamentally from standard medical or municipal waste due to its potential biological hazards. These materials can contain live pathogens, requiring specialized handling and treatment protocols.

Healthcare facilities must implement rigorous screening, segregation, and treatment processes to manage these high-risk materials effectively.

What Regulatory Frameworks Govern Infectious Waste?

Complex regulatory landscapes shape infectious waste management practices. Multiple agencies, including CDC, EPA, and OSHA, establish guidelines that medical facilities must rigorously follow.

Compliance requires ongoing staff training, systematic documentation, and continuous technological adaptation.
